How to get an issue assigned

Warning

Submitted PRs without proper assignment will NOT be accepted.

At Walnut, we highly value code quality. We ensure that only the best contributors work on our code, which is why our selection process is careful and thorough.

We do not assign issues on a first-come, first-served basis. Primarily, we assign issues to contributors who have previously worked with us. However, if you are new, don’t worry—we are eager to attract new talent. We just need to get to know you and ensure you have the skills to complete the task. Below are detailed instructions on how to get an issue assigned.

It’s Your First Contribution to Walnut’s Repositories

  1. Add a comment briefly introducing yourself and provide your OnlyDust profile if you want to, so we can assess if your skills match the issue.
  2. Provide detailed technical instructions on how you plan to accomplish the task. Mention which functions or files you plan to edit and what code you intend to write. This will help you coming up with an appropriate solution and make sure you're not heading in the wrong direction.

You Have Already Contributed to Any of Walnut's Repositories

Please comment and provide some technical details on how you plan to accomplish the task. We may choose to assign to you even if you only comment "I'm up for it!" if nobody else is interested in the issue.

⌨️ Coding conventions

The project is already pre-configured with Eslint, TypeScript, and Prettier.

Check for any linting issues:

pnpm lint

Run prettier before committing:

pnpm prettier
